穿越时空的编程之旅——汇编写游戏,揭秘那些“牛人”的杰作
亲爱的读者们,你是否曾想过,那些在电脑屏幕上跳跃的贪吃蛇、下落的字母,甚至是惊险刺激的“小蜜蜂”,竟然是由一种古老而神秘的编程语言——汇编语言,编织而成的?今天,就让我们一起穿越时空,探索汇编写游戏的奇妙世界吧!
一、汇编语言的魅力:与硬件共舞
汇编语言,被誉为“计算机的母语”,它直接与计算机硬件对话,拥有极高的执行效率。相较于高级编程语言,汇编语言更接近于机器语言,需要程序员对计算机的硬件结构有深入的了解。正是这种与硬件的紧密联系,让汇编语言在游戏开发领域大放异彩。

二、汇编写游戏:那些“牛人”的杰作
1. 经典贪吃蛇:汇编语言的代表作
还记得那个经典的贪吃蛇游戏吗?它是由汇编语言编写的,通过a、d、w、s键控制蛇的移动,游戏界面简洁明了。这款游戏展示了汇编语言在实现游戏逻辑、界面显示和键盘输入处理等方面的强大能力。

2. 打字游戏:汇编语言的趣味实践
汇编语言不仅可以编写游戏,还能编写打字游戏。在这个游戏中,26个英文字母随机从屏幕顶部下落,玩家需在字母下落过程中输入相应的字母。正确输入则字母消失,分数增加;输入错误则字母继续下落。这款游戏不仅考验玩家的打字速度,还锻炼了他们的反应能力。

3. “小蜜蜂”:汇编语言的经典复制品
“用汇编做的小游戏 牛人 好像是小蜜蜂”这款游戏,可能是一个类似经典游戏“小蜜蜂”的复制品。它由一位技术高超的程序员用汇编语言编写,展示了汇编语言在实现游戏画面、音效和操作逻辑等方面的能力。
三、汇编写游戏:那些“牛人”的启示
1. 汇编语言需要扎实的编程基础
汇编语言编程难度较高,程序员需要具备扎实的编程基础和出色的逻辑思维能力。只有掌握了计算机的硬件结构,才能在汇编语言的世界里游刃有余。
2. 汇编写游戏需要耐心和毅力
汇编语言编程过程繁琐,需要程序员具备极高的耐心和毅力。在编写游戏的过程中,可能会遇到各种意想不到的问题,需要程序员不断调试和优化。
3. 汇编写游戏具有极高的成就感
虽然汇编语言编程难度较大,但完成一款游戏后,那种成就感是无法用言语表达的。这种成就感来源于对计算机硬件的深入了解,以及对编程技术的精湛掌握。
四、汇编写游戏:未来仍有机会
尽管现在游戏开发领域的主流语言是C、C++、Java等高级编程语言,但汇编语言在游戏开发领域仍有一定的市场。一些对性能要求极高的游戏,如赛车游戏、射击游戏等,仍会采用汇编语言进行优化。
此外,随着游戏开发技术的不断发展,汇编语言在游戏开发领域的应用也将越来越广泛。相信在不久的将来,汇编语言将会在游戏开发领域发挥更大的作用。
亲爱的读者们,通过今天的分享,你是否对汇编写游戏有了更深入的了解呢?让我们一起期待,那些用汇编语言编写的游戏,在未来会带给我们怎样的惊喜吧!